In its rich history, cinematic animation has developed from silent monochrome images to sound-filled shorts that ran theatrically with newsreels and aventure serials, and ultimately to prestigious feature films like Disney's Fantasia. This expanded update of Graham Webb's The Animated Film Encyclopedia: 1900-1979 (McFarland, 2000) is a compehensive listing of theatrical animated cartoons throughout the 20th Century, as well as significant animated sequences in live-action films. New to the second edition are several titles involving computer-generated animation (CGI), including the resoundingly successful Toy Story (1995).
